About cyclohexa-1,3-diene;dimethyl carbonate

cyclohexa-1,3-diene;dimethyl carbonate (PubChem CID 22160247) has the molecular formula C9H14O3 and a molecular weight of 170.21 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is cyclohexa-1,3-diene;dimethyl carbonate.
